Output ec0c8021d26981eac4181fb771381f66d2193e40714a9f7ab506bf1ccf798781:3

value
11892100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b11c5d5efc6323d721f0ba3e1660883ca3656548 OP_EQUAL
address
MQ3dpCZkLmKjzi3SDRfxyjSCU7xCJf3JvT
transaction
ec0c8021d26981eac4181fb771381f66d2193e40714a9f7ab506bf1ccf798781
spent
true